Nazri Rahimov (12-3, 7 KOs)
TKO-10
Irving Berry (23-10-2, 10 KOs)
- This bout was fought for the vacant Universal Boxing Organization (UBO) World super lightweight title.
- Berry was a late substitute. Rahimov was originally scheduled to fight African Boxing Union super lightweight champion Latibu Muwonge (7-0, 0 KOs) for the vacant UBO World title. Muwonge was forded to withdraw because of a visa problem.
- Berry was fighting for the first time since his TKO-3 loss to Pablo Vicente on October 5, 2018.
- Rahimov dropped Berry in round 10. Berry beat the referee's count but his corner determined he had taken more than enough punishment and threw in the towel.
